Understanding the Fundamentals of Artificial Intelligence
The ‘Beginner’s Guide to Understanding Artificial Intelligence’ is designed to introduce the core concepts and technologies that underpin the rapidly evolving field of artificial intelligence. At its core, artificial intelligence refers to the development of computer systems that can perform tasks that typically require human intelligence, such as visual perception, speech recognition, and decision-making.
Key Concepts in Artificial Intelligence
To grasp the basics of artificial intelligence, it’s essential to understand the key concepts that drive its functionality. These include Machine Learning, a subset of AI that enables systems to learn from data without being explicitly programmed, and Deep Learning, a type of machine learning that uses neural networks to analyze complex data patterns. Applications of Artificial Intelligence
Artificial intelligence has a wide range of applications across various industries, from healthcare and finance to transportation and education. For instance, AI-powered systems can be used to analyze medical images, detect financial fraud, and optimize traffic flow. Types of Artificial Intelligence
There are several types of artificial intelligence, including Narrow or Weak AI, which is designed to perform a specific task, and General or Strong AI, which aims to match human intelligence across a broad range of tasks. Challenges and Limitations of Artificial Intelligence
While artificial intelligence has made tremendous progress in recent years, it still faces several challenges and limitations. These include issues related to Data Quality, Bias in AI Systems, and the need for more transparent and explainable AI models. Frequently Asked Questions
What is Artificial Intelligence?
Artificial Intelligence refers to the development of computer systems that can perform tasks that would typically require human intelligence, such as learning, problem-solving, and decision-making. These systems are designed to operate autonomously, making decisions based on data and algorithms. The goal of AI is to create machines that can think and act like humans, improving efficiency and accuracy in various industries.
How Does Artificial Intelligence Work?
AI systems work by using complex algorithms to analyze large amounts of data. This data is used to train the AI model, enabling it to make predictions or decisions. The process involves machine learning, where the system learns from the data and improves its performance over time. As the AI system processes more data, it becomes more accurate and effective in its tasks.
What are the Different Types of Artificial Intelligence?
There are several types of AI, including Narrow or Weak AI, which is designed to perform a specific task, and General or Strong AI, which aims to match human intelligence across a wide range of tasks. Other types include Superintelligence, which refers to AI that surpasses human intelligence, and Reactive Machines, which react to specific inputs without learning or memory.
What are the Applications of Artificial Intelligence?
AI has numerous applications across various industries, including healthcare, where it’s used for diagnosis and treatment recommendations, finance, where it’s used for risk analysis and portfolio management, and transportation, where it’s used in autonomous vehicles. AI is also used in customer service, improving user experience through chatbots and virtual assistants.
